小尺寸钢筋混凝土梁模型实验研究
Experimental study on reinforced concrete beam model with small size
受到试验仪器及试验费用的限制,利用小尺寸钢筋混凝土梁模型对钢筋混凝土构件的各种性能进行研究是十分必要的。本文主要针对小尺寸钢筋混凝土梁模型试验展开研究。首先根据实验室加载设备设计钢筋混凝土梁模型的尺寸,之后对该混凝土模型梁进行纵向受拉钢筋及箍筋设计,最后将制作好的混凝土模型梁在实验机上进行四点受弯试验。试验结果表明小尺寸钢筋混凝土构件是能够发生混凝土梁的典型破坏,进而能够反映混凝土梁的各种力学性能。
Under the limit of equipment and budget of experiment, it is necessary of using small size specimen to study the performance of reinforced concrete components. In this paper, the research on model test of small specimen was carried out. First, the size of the small specimen was decided due to the limitation of equipment. Then, the steel bars in small specimen were designed. Finally, the four point bending test of the small specimen of concrete beam was carried out. The result shows that the typical failure of concrete beam could happen and the small specimen can be used to study the mechanical performance of concrete beam.
